<p><strong>Who</strong>: Megan, Merchandising<br />
<strong>What</strong>: <a href="http://www.amazon.com/Holidays-Ice-Stories-David-Sedaris/dp/0316779237" target="_blank">Holidays on Ice</a> by David Sedaris<br />
<strong>Why</strong>: I’ve read it every holiday season since college, and I still laugh just as hard as I did the first time.  All of his books are hilarious and incredibly well written.</p>
<p><strong>Who</strong>: Beatrice, Accessories<br />
<strong>What</strong>: <a href="http://www.amazon.com/Shutter-Island-Dennis-Lehane/dp/0061703257/ref=sr_1_1?ie=UTF8&amp;s=books&amp;qid=1261001988&amp;sr=1-1" target="_blank">Shutter Island</a>, by Dennis Lehane<br />
<strong>Why</strong>: It’s a great psychological thriller, by a great writer – a combination that should be easy to come by, but is actually very hard to find!  Lehane has great powers of description, and really makes you empathize with all the characters – good and evil.  A multi-faceted thriller that’s impossible to put down.</p>
<p><strong>Who</strong>: Lauren, DVF Stylist<br />
<strong>What</strong>: <a href="http://www.amazon.com/Kafka-Shore-Haruki-Murakami/dp/1400079276/ref=sr_1_1?ie=UTF8&amp;s=books&amp;qid=1261002084&amp;sr=1-1" target="_blank">Kafka on the Shore</a> by Haruki Murakami (2002)<br />
<strong>Why</strong>: This book immerses me in Japanese history while taking me for a ride through inconceivable fantasies.</p>
<p><strong>Who</strong>: Sarah, Architecture<br />
<strong>What</strong>:  <a href="http://www.amazon.com/Why-Architecture-Matters/dp/030014430X/ref=sr_1_1?ie=UTF8&amp;s=books&amp;qid=1261002116&amp;sr=1-1" target="_blank">Why Architecture Matters</a> by Paul Goldberg<br />
<strong>Why:</strong> Just got it yesterday from my roomies for Christmas….(they saw the author interviewed on <em>The Colbert Report</em>)</p>
<p><strong>Who</strong>: Marty, Store Manager/Woodbury<br />
<strong>What</strong>:  <a href="http://www.amazon.com/Breaking-Dawn-Twilight-Saga-Book/dp/031606792X/ref=sr_1_1?ie=UTF8&amp;s=books&amp;qid=1261002166&amp;sr=1-1" target="_blank">Breaking Dawn</a> by Stephanie Meyer<br />
<strong>Why</strong>:  For everyone, there is a different interpretation&#8230; but for me, it was about Bella&#8217;s strength and how love gave her this great strength&#8230; it was great to follow her development from this young, fragile girl to emerge as a huge pillar of strength at the end&#8230; and I&#8217;m a total sucker for romance.</p>
<p><strong>Who</strong>: Ashley, Creative<br />
<strong>What</strong>: <a href="http://www.amazon.com/Journeys-Socrates-Adventure-Dan-Millman/dp/0060833025/ref=sr_1_1?ie=UTF8&amp;s=books&amp;qid=1261002231&amp;sr=1-1" target="_blank">The Journeys of Socrates</a><br />
<strong>Why</strong>: My mother insisted that it was the “best book she has ever read”&#8230;and so she might be right.  Even though I have not read any of his other books, it proved to be an amazing story. We are all on a journey in life and anyone who has spent any time in self-exploration will appreciate this latest book from Dan Millan. His writing is down to earth and thought provoking, and the ending holds the best surprise. It is a true story about how life always comes full circle.</p>
<p><strong>Who</strong>: Valeria, Sales<br />
<strong>What</strong>: <a href="http://www.amazon.com/Curious-Incident-Night-Time-Today-Show/dp/0385512104/ref=sr_1_1?ie=UTF8&amp;s=books&amp;qid=1261002291&amp;sr=1-1" target="_blank">The Curious Incident of the Dog at Night Time</a> by Mark Haddon<br />
<strong>Why</strong>: It’s so fresh, funny and sad at the same time. Once I started I couldn’t stop reading it – it’s entertaining and it gives a lot to think of.</p>
<p><strong>Who</strong>: Eva, Southampton Store<br />
<strong>What</strong>: <a href="http://www.amazon.com/Monster-Florence-Douglas-Preston/dp/0446581275/ref=sr_1_1?ie=UTF8&amp;s=books&amp;qid=1261002339&amp;sr=1-1-spell" target="_blank">The Monster of Florence</a> by Douglas Preston<br />
<strong>Why</strong>: It&#8217;s the true story of Italy&#8217;s most infamous serial killer who murdered and ravaged the bodies of young lovers across Florence&#8217;s countryside. If you&#8217;re like me and can&#8217;t get enough Hannibal Lector and Cold Case Files on A&amp;E, it&#8217;s a must read.  Upon moving his family to Italy, Preston learns that he lives next door to where one of the horrific crimes took place and teams up with Mario Spezi, a journalist who had been covering the case since the 80s, to further investigate. And in an interesting twist, the story involves the crazy prosecutor who just put Amanda Knox behind bars. Not exactly in the holiday spirit, but a great book to enjoy with a fire and eggnog.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><a href="http://www.amazon.com/Love-Your-Style-Define-Personal/dp/0061833126"><img class="alignleft size-medium wp-image-4308" title="picture-7" src="http://inside.dvf.com/dvf_magazine/wp-content/uploads/2009/09/picture-7-223x300.png" alt="" width="223" height="300" /></a>Last night, DVF hosted the book party for Amanda Brooks&#8217; new style tome &#8220;<em>I Love Your Style</em>,&#8221; with foreword by Diane herself. And we love the book! Here, Amanda gives us six stylish ways to find your own style&#8230; but for more, you&#8217;ll have to <a href="http://www.amazon.com/Love-Your-Style-Define-Personal/dp/0061833126" target="_blank">pre-order your copy</a>, stop by the DVF shop to buy one, or check out <a href="http://www.style.com/vogue/voguedaily/tag/amanda-brooks/" target="_blank">Amanda&#8217;s <em>Vogue</em></a> blog!</p>
<p><!--[if gte mso 9]><xml> <o:DocumentProperties> <o:Template>Normal.dotm</o:Template> <o:Revision>0</o:Revision> <o:TotalTime>0</o:TotalTime> <o:Pages>1</o:Pages> <o:Words>200</o:Words> <o:Characters>1141</o:Characters> <o:Company>Diane von Furstenberg Studios</o:Company> <o:Lines>9</o:Lines> <o:Paragraphs>2</o:Paragraphs> <o:CharactersWithSpaces>1401</o:CharactersWithSpaces> <o:Version>12.0</o:Version> </o:DocumentProperties> <o:OfficeDocumentSettings> <o:AllowPNG /> </o:OfficeDocumentSettings> </xml><![endif]--><!--[if gte mso 9]><xml> <w:WordDocument> <w:Zoom>0</w:Zoom> <w:TrackMoves>false</w:TrackMoves> <w:TrackFormatting /> <w:PunctuationKerning /> <w:DrawingGridHorizontalSpacing>18 pt</w:DrawingGridHorizontalSpacing> <w:DrawingGridVerticalSpacing>18 pt</w:DrawingGridVerticalSpacing> <w:DisplayHorizontalDrawingGridEvery>0</w:DisplayHorizontalDrawingGridEvery> <w:DisplayVerticalDrawingGridEvery>0</w:DisplayVerticalDrawingGridEvery> <w:ValidateAgainstSchemas /> <w:SaveIfXMLInvalid>false</w:SaveIfXMLInvalid> <w:IgnoreMixedContent>false</w:IgnoreMixedContent> <w:AlwaysShowPlaceholderText>false</w:AlwaysShowPlaceholderText> <w:Compatibility> <w:BreakWrappedTables /> <w:DontGrowAutofit /> <w:DontAutofitConstrainedTables /> <w:DontVertAlignInTxbx /> </w:Compatibility> </w:WordDocument> </xml><![endif]--><!--[if gte mso 9]><xml> <w:LatentStyles DefLockedState="false" LatentStyleCount="276"> </w:LatentStyles> </xml><![endif]--> <em>Six ways to find your style:</em></p>
<p><strong>1. Make tear sheets. </strong>Read lots of magazines and books and tear out or make copies of things that resonate with you, whether they are whole outfits or just appealing color combinations, beautiful textiles, scenes that evoke a certain era or feeling, or anything at all that you think you want to express with your clothes.</p>
<p><strong>2. Write down your style history.</strong> Reflect on your life and take note of the things that have influenced you most.</p>
<p><strong>3. Try a lot of looks</strong>. Experiment. Everything I know about my style and my taste has been the result of trying out every look in the book.</p>
<p><strong>4. Constantly ask yourself questions.</strong> The more answers you have the more defined your style will be. What proportions flatter you? What fabrics and colors do you love? What kind of mood do you seek to create around yourself? What pieces in your closet do you come back to again and again?</p>
<p><strong>5. Find your style icons and inspiration.</strong> Identifying with someone whose style you admire is a great way to figure out whether something is you. Inspiration equals personal style.</p>
<p><strong>6. Make an effort. </strong>Style will not appear in your life on its own. I always feel and look my best when I&#8217;m dressed in evening clothes because that is when I make the biggest effort. We can&#8217;t go the whole nine yards every morning, but muster what energy you can and you&#8217;ll feel better all day long.</p>

<p>This Independence Day weekend we&#8217;re looking forward to curling up with a good book. So whether the next few days have you near or far, here are a few reads recommended by Diane and the rest of the DVF team.</p>
<p><strong>Diane</strong>: A few that I am reading this summer&#8230;<em><a title="Madam de Stael" href="http://www.amazon.com/Madame-Stael-First-Modern-Woman/dp/1934633178/ref=sr_1_2?ie=UTF8&amp;s=books&amp;qid=1246371331&amp;sr=8-2" target="_blank">Madame de Stael</a></em> by Francine de Plessix Gray,<em> <a title="The Bolter" href="http://www.amazon.com/Bolter-Frances-Osborne/dp/0307270149/ref=sr_1_1?ie=UTF8&amp;s=books&amp;qid=1246371518&amp;sr=1-1" target="_blank">The Bolter</a></em> by Frances Osborne, <em><a title="Chicago" href="http://www.amazon.com/Chicago-Novel-Alaa-Al-Aswany/dp/0061452564/ref=sr_1_1?ie=UTF8&amp;s=books&amp;qid=1246371597&amp;sr=1-1" target="_blank">Chicago</a></em> by Alaa El Aswany and Gloria Vanderbilt&#8217;s new book, <em><a title="Erotic Tale" href="http://www.amazon.com/Obsession-Erotic-Tale-Gloria-Vanderbilt/dp/0061734896/ref=sr_1_1?ie=UTF8&amp;s=books&amp;qid=1246371663&amp;sr=1-1" target="_blank">Obsession: An Erotic Tale.</a></em></p>
<p><strong>Abigail</strong>: <em><a title="Snow" href="http://www.amazon.com/Snow-Orhan-Pamuk/dp/0375706860/ref=sr_1_1?ie=UTF8&amp;s=books&amp;qid=1246371945&amp;sr=1-1" target="_blank">Snow</a></em> by Nobel Prize winner Orhan Pamuk.  I read it last summer but have picked it up again because it is so beautiful and so timely as it deals with the clash of radical Islam and western ideals.<em> <a title="Work Hard. Be Nice. " href="http://www.amazon.com/Work-Hard-Be-Nice-Promising/dp/1565125169/ref=sr_1_1?ie=UTF8&amp;s=books&amp;qid=1246372005&amp;sr=1-1" target="_blank">Work Hard. Be Nice.</a></em> by <em>Washington Post</em> education writer Jay Mathews. Mathews follows two young teachers as they pioneer KIPP, one of the most successful charter school programs in America.An honest view of these two young teachers who are changing the way we think about education. As a board member of KIPP, I was especially excited to see the KIPP program chronicled by Jay Mathews!</p>
<p><strong>Luisella</strong>: <em><a title="Three Cups of Tea" href="http://www.amazon.com/Three-Cups-Tea-Mission-Promote/dp/0143038257/ref=sr_1_1?ie=UTF8&amp;s=books&amp;qid=1246372452&amp;sr=1-1#" target="_blank">Three Cups of Tea</a></em>: One Man&#8217;s Mission to Promote Peace&#8230;One School at a Time by Greg Mortenson and David Oliver Relin. This book shows that one ordinary person with a strong determination and vision can really make a difference and contribute to change the world.</p>
<p><strong>April</strong>: Mine is not glamorous or a trashy beach read, but <a title="The Wonder of Boys" href="http://www.amazon.com/Wonder-Boys-Michael-Gurian/dp/1585425281/ref=sr_1_1?ie=UTF8&amp;s=books&amp;qid=1246373438&amp;sr=1-1" target="_blank"><em>The Wonder of Boy</em>s</a> by Michael Gurian. It is about what parents/mentors/educators can do to shape boys into exceptional men.</p>
<p><strong>Colleen</strong>: <em><a title="the winner stands alone" href="http://www.amazon.com/Winner-Stands-Alone-Novel/dp/0061750441/ref=sr_1_1?ie=UTF8&amp;s=books&amp;qid=1246397717&amp;sr=8-1" target="_blank">The Winner Stands Alone</a></em> by Paulo Coelho - He is one of my favorite authors.  He is usually very spiritual in his writing (i.e. The Alchemist) and I am very interested to see how he folds fashion and cinema into his repertoire.</p>
<p><strong>Daniela</strong>: <em><a title="The Last Lecture" href="http://www.amazon.com/Last-Lecture-Randy-Pausch/dp/1401323251/ref=sr_1_1?ie=UTF8&amp;s=books&amp;qid=1246373181&amp;sr=1-1#" target="_blank">The Last Lecture</a></em> by Randy Pausch. It&#8217;s a quick read and is so inspiring.  It reminds us to follow our dreams and achieve them, as life is so precious. It&#8217;s one of those books that you&#8217;ll want to keep around and read once in a while.</p>
<p><strong>Cesar</strong>: <em><a title="Me Talk Pretty One Day" href="http://www.amazon.com/Me-Talk-Pretty-One-Day/dp/0316776963/ref=sr_1_1?ie=UTF8&amp;s=books&amp;qid=1246373696&amp;sr=1-1" target="_blank">Me Talk Pretty One Day</a></em> by David Sedaris. The best pieces in here are funny to the point that I almost needed an oxygen tank to restore normal breathing after laughing so hard for so long. The only possible reason not to read this book is if you&#8217;d rather hear the author&#8217;s intrinsically funny speaking voice narrating his story. In that case, get <em>Me Talk Pretty One Day</em> <a title="Me Talk Pretty One Day audio" href="http://www.amazon.com/Me-Talk-Pretty-One-Day/dp/1586210661/ref=sr_1_1?ie=UTF8&amp;s=books&amp;qid=1246373794&amp;sr=1-1" target="_blank">on audio</a>.</p>
<p><strong>Katie</strong>: <em><a href="http://www.amazon.com/Brief-Wondrous-Life-Oscar-Wao/dp/1594483299/ref=sr_1_1?ie=UTF8&amp;s=books&amp;qid=1246397851&amp;sr=1-1" target="_blank">The Brief Wondrous Life of Oscar Wao</a></em> by Junot Diaz. Pulitzer Prize winner! A lot of Junot Diaz&#8217;s writing seems to stem from his personal experience of growing up as a Dominican-American. This novel recounts the history of one family while also recounting the history of the island itself. It&#8217;s both tragic and hilarious at the same time.  Best book EVER!</p>

<p>Last week DVF hosted a book launch party for <a href="http://www.amazon.com/Womenomics-Write-Your-Rules-Success/dp/0061697184" target="_blank"><em>Womenomics: Write Your Own Rules for Success</em></a>, the new tome by Claire Shipman and Katty Kay. The two women (of <em>Good Morning American</em> and <em>BBC News </em>respectively) collaborated on the new book, which explores the role of women in the workplace and gives you insight on how to have it all! The authors were divine in their DVF dresses and everyone from Katy Couric to Al Roker to Charlie Gibson stopped by to congratulate them. Plus! The book just debuted at #10 on the <em>NYTimes</em> bestseller list (Advice/How to) for the week of June 21st! Congrats to Claire and Katty, who even with their busy schedules managed to pop by our Sample Sale last week and pick up some book tour-worthy wardrobe additions.</p>

<p>Ike Ude - painter, photographer, publisher - he is a man of many trades and talents, and most recently he is the author of <em>STYLE FILE: The World&#8217;s Most Elegantly Dressed</em>. And we think this might be one of the most elegant books to cross our coffee tables in a while. Through interview and photographs,  							Ike profiles 55 iconic arbiters of style, including John Galliano, Oscar de la Renta, and Diane von Furstenberg. Photographed at DVF studio, Diane reveals her favorite phrases, movies, and role models (you&#8217;ll never guess what world leader she thinks has the most distinctive style).</p>

<p>The annual event (third year running) was created by Printed Matter, the NY non-profit devoted to artists&#8217; publications. Held at Phillips de Pury &amp; Company, it will showcase contemporary art books, art catalogues, artists&#8217; books, art periodicals, and zines from over 140 international exhibitors. Look for magazines like Pin-Up and Art on Paper, as well as displays from John McWhinnie at Glenn Horowitz Bookseller and the 13th Street gallery, White Columns.</p>
<p>The fair kicks off Thursday night with a benefit preview, and then runs from Friday, October 23rd thru Sunday October 24th</p>
